Opalized Bones Alter Australia’s Prehistoric History

Beginning with an excavation in 1984, an opal mine in Lightning Ridge (in rural New South Wales, Australia) suddenly became a hotbed for fossilized—and subsequently opalized—dinosaur bones. Róisín Murphy: Incapable

Teaming up with longtime collaborator DJ Parrot (aka Crooked Man), Róisín Murphy releases “Incapable”—a house banger about being emotionally inept. The prolific singer/songwriter/producer offers flawless vocals that sashay over the twitchy beat and groovy bass line. The song ebbs and flows gloriously for almost nine minutes of immaculate production.
